On August 1, 2026, OpenAI publicly disclosed “Astra,” describing an internal version of Astra as its “next major model.” You can read more about that here: https://openai.com/index/ten-advances-in-mathematics/. This market will resolve to "Yes" if the next OpenAI “Astra” model added to the Humanity’s Last Exam results at https://agi.safe.ai/ has an HLE Accuracy of at least the specified percentage at 12:00 PM ET on the calendar date following the date on which it first appears on the site. Otherwise, this market will resolve to "No". If a model first appears on the site but is removed before 12:00 PM ET on the following calendar date, its appearance will not qualify as added to the Humanity’s Last Exam results. A qualifying model must be named "Astra" (including variants or successor branding such as Astra 1, Astra 6, Astra X, GPT-6 Astra, or similar naming or rebranded versions), or be confirmed to be the same model referenced in the announcement by OpenAI or by a consensus of credible reporting. The percentage displayed as “HLE Accuracy” for the model in its result card on the “AI Progress on Humanity’s Last Exam” chart at https://agi.safe.ai/ will be used to resolve this market. This market will resolve solely based on the displayed HLE Accuracy, regardless of the model’s Calibration Error, chart position, other configuration scores, or any underlying granular or unrounded data presented elsewhere. If multiple qualifying models are added to the Humanity’s Last Exam results on the same calendar date (ET), the model with the highest HLE Accuracy will be used for resolution. Models added to the results on the calendar date following the initial qualifying model’s first appearance will not be considered. A qualifying model must be newly added to the Humanity’s Last Exam results at https://agi.safe.ai/. Whether the model was previously released, publicly accessible, in beta, or otherwise available before appearing on the site is irrelevant for this market. The resolution source for this market is the official Humanity’s Last Exam website found at https://agi.safe.ai/. If this resolution source is unavailable at 12:00 PM ET on the calendar date following the date on which the qualifying model first appears on the site, this market will resolve based on the first subsequent instance at which the model’s HLE Accuracy becomes available on the site. If it remains unavailable through the end of the seventh day after the qualifying model first appears on the site or if no qualifying model is added by December 31, 2026, 11:59 PM ET, this market will resolve to "No".OpenAI’s September 3 launch of GPT-6 Astra, its latest frontier large language model, drives trader sentiment on the Humanity’s Last Exam (HLE) debut. Official benchmarks released with the model show Astra scoring 57.2% on HLE with tools—below the 65% posted by its predecessor GPT-5.6 Sol and several competing systems—while leading on computer-use, browser, coding, and cybersecurity tasks such as ExploitBench and Terminal-Bench. Astra’s rollout followed weeks of delays triggered by its “critical” cybersecurity classification under OpenAI’s Preparedness Framework, limiting advanced exploit capabilities at launch. Full availability to ChatGPT paid users and the API begins in the coming days, with potential for tool or agent updates to influence final leaderboard entries.
